For the Spring-Summer 2013, Agatha designed a collection that revisits her classic forms and shapes: hoops, ladders, michelins, pianos, self-portraits, mirrors, cages, baby walkers, trays, tangles, roosters, etc...
"Michelin (a Spanish word for love handles), one of my obsessions.
The Michelin company wrote me once complaining about my using their company name for my dresses. I never meant to use their name for comercial reasons. It is very difficult to sell 'michelins' (love handles) in a socity obsessed with being/looking thin." — Agatha —
